Through the first two rounds, David Toms has absolutely destroyed the Crowne Plaza Invitational. Toms matched his first-round 62 with another 62 in the second round, and entering Saturday’s play, he sits on top of the leaderboard with a commanding seven-stroke lead.
Crowne Plaza Invitational Leaderboard: David Toms Aims To Continue Dominating Performance
Toms’ play has been remarkably consistent. In each of his two rounds, he scored eight birdies without committing a single bogey. Toms is a week removed from his Players Championship run that ultimately ended in a playoff loss to K.J. Choi; the 44-year-old won his last PGA Tour event in 2006.
